Skills
Define skill library
Settings → HR → Skills → create list of competencies relevant for your company:
- Technical:
Python,Figma,AWS,SAP, etc. - Soft:
Public speaking,Project management,Negotiation - Language:
English B2,Spanish A2
Assign to employees
For each employee, add skills from profile. For each, indicate level (e.g. Basic / Intermediate / Advanced / Expert).
Certifications
Unlike skills, certifications have an expiry date and a physical certificate (PDF):Add certification
From employee profile → Certifications → + New. Name (e.g. “AWS Solutions Architect”), issuing body, date, expiry, attached PDF.

Skill matrix
Aggregated view: department × skill × level. Useful for:- Identifying gaps (critical skills without enough experts)
- Planning training
- Assigning people to projects
- Succession planning
Linked training
If you have a training system:- Assign courses to fill gaps
- Track completion
- Auto-update skills/certifications on completion
